High Voltage Battery Enclosure Not Properly Sealed

Recalled: October 14, 2022 ~797 units affected 22V771

Description

General Motors, LLC (GM) is recalling certain 2022 BrightDrop EV600 and 2022-2023 GMC Hummer EV Pickup electric vehicles. The high voltage battery pack enclosure may not be properly sealed, allowing water to enter the pack.

Injuries / Consequence

Water accumulation in the high voltage battery pack can cause a loss of drive power,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y

The remedy is currently under development. Owner notification letters were mailed April 13, 2023. Second letters will be sent once the remedy is available. Owners may contact EV Concierge at 1-833-HUMMER-EV, and BrightDrop Service Operations and Support at 1-888-987-4377. GM's number for this recall is N222380031.
